Conference Calls
On April 16, 2020 EPA hosted a call on the recently announced plan to reduce burden for certain stakeholders subject to TSCA Fees Rule requirements for EPA-initiated risk evaluations. Read the transcript of the call and find the slides for the presentation.
On February 24, 2020 EPA hosted a conference call to review certain provisions of the Fees for the Administration of the Toxic Substances Act rule. In light of the recent publication of the preliminary list of manufacturers/importers subject to risk evaluation fees, the Agency gave a brief overview of the fees associated with an EPA-initiated risk evaluation, the entities subject to fees, requirements for self-identification, and how fees will be divided among those identified on final lists. In December 2019, EPA hosted a conference call to give a brief overview of the fees associated with an EPA-initiated risk evaluation, the creation of the preliminary list that identifies manufacturers and importers subject to fees, and how fees will be divided among the identified businesses. Webinars
EPA hosted a series of webinars on changes to EPA's Central Data Exchange (CDX) as a result of the final Fees for the Administration of the Toxic Substances Control Act rule. The webinars covered using CDX for upfront payment of fees under the final rule. Slides and a recording of the October 10, 2019 webinar are available here.
